Output ebc6880bdcd21c553e70a0678066cbaa6789d33d17800dc6fe972d0e02653c5a:1

value
7430773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35367d44141d27b91fdf4c62d0c877e4f13ba27e OP_EQUAL
address
36YP1hGZACvEGh8aBL7agWPCMRyGSiMhsg
transaction
ebc6880bdcd21c553e70a0678066cbaa6789d33d17800dc6fe972d0e02653c5a
spent
true